I have a Sonicwall firewall in this business which is our perimeter device, and it has 5 ports on. I'm in the middle of some massive network changes here so all 5 are currently in use. I have 3 ADSL lines coming into it and at the moment 2 separate LAN segments because I'm re-addressing this network. We have also just had a fibre line connected and I am keen to move services across to this ASAP, but need to do so without interrupting the existing ADSL connections for now as they all handle various incoming/outgoing services which need to stay live while I do this.

 

So the question is how to free up a router port. Easy solution I thought, combine both the LAN segments onto one router port since they are on different VLAN's and the router can create virtual LAN ports, should be easy right?

 

So at the moment I have LAN segment 132.140.x.x (Don't ask about that IP address range, I inherited it) on port 0 and LAN segment 10.100.x.x on router port 4. They are both connected to their respective VLAN on my network which is a port on the switch with the untagged VLAN set appropriately. Great this all works. The Sonicwall router is also the default router for Lan Segment 132.140.x.x but for my new network the routing is all handled by the switch with a static IP route to send traffic out to the internet on the appropriate IP address. This has been working absolutely fine for the last 2 months or so.

 

Hope you're still with me!

 

So to move both LAN segments onto one router port I'm doing the following

 

Set VLAN 999 (which is my internet VLAN) as tagged on the router port that currently handles just the 132.140.x.x network

Remove the IP address from router port 4 which stops all internet traffic on the 10.100.x.x range as expected

Add a virtual LAN port on interface 0 with VLAN 999 specified and the same IP address as router port 4 had previously.

 

By my reckoning because the VLAN is set as tagged on both the router and the switch it should work, but it doesn't! I get no internet access on my 10.100.x.x network after making this change, but the 132.140.x.x network carries on as usual.

 

HOWEVER, this is the odd thing. From an SSH session on the core switch I can ping both the router on it's VLAN 999 address and ping outside of the network, but only from the switch not from any of the network segments. Looking at the ARP list it also shows the correct IP address is on the correct port, so the switch is communicating with the router on VLAN 999 on that port, it knows which port to send traffic to for that IP address, just for some bizarre reason I have no connectivity from any of my machines even thou it's actually the same VLAN and same address that it was communicating perfectly happily on just moments previously on the other router port.

 

Can anyone see what I'm potentially doing wrong because I'm stumped at the moment!

I would take a look at the routing table on the Sonicwall (assume that's possible) to make sure you have all routes present and pointing to the correct subinterfaces/gateways. Do the same on the switch.

 

Also double check your VLAN setup and virtual LAN port.

Thanks, you were actually correct, but I managed to get there myself in the mean time. I realised it was EXACTLY the same problem I had when I first set it up, I needed a static route on the Sonicwall to send the traffic back to the network switch as by default the router assumes it is the default gateway, which it isn't for my network. As soon as I sorted that out it worked as expected. It's ALWAYS the simple things!
